Peach Bourbon Pie
Ingredients
The filling
-
5
cups
thinly sliced peaches
-
½
cup
white sugar
-
½
cup
brown sugar
-
½
cup
flour
-
1
tsp
ground cinnamon
-
¼
tsp
salt
-
pinch
nutmeg
-
2
tsp
lemon zest
-
1
tsp
lemon juice
-
¼
cup
bourbon
-
1
Tbsp
butter
The crust
-
1
recipe
chilled double pie crust (unbaked)
-
milk
for brushing
-
sugar
for sprinkling
Instructions
- Whisk together flour, white sugar, brown sugar, cinnamon, nutmeg, salt, and lemon zest in a large bowl.
- Add the peaches and toss to combine, then add lemon juice and bourbon, tossing until coated.
- Roll out the bottom pie crust and place it in a pie pan, then pour in the peach filling and smooth the top.
- Cut butter into small pieces and sprinkle over the peaches.
- Roll out the second half of the dough for the top crust, place it over the pie, and pinch the edges together.
- Brush the top crust with milk and sprinkle with sugar, then cut slits for ventilation.
- Bake at 400°F for 30 minutes, then reduce the heat to 350°F and bake for an additional 25-30 minutes until golden brown.
